0.611 convert Decimal to percentage ​

Mathematics
1 answer:
diamong [38]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

0.611 = 61.1%

Step-by-step explanation:

'Percent (%)' means 'out of one hundred':

p% = p 'out of one hundred',

p% = p/100 = p ÷ 100.

Note:

100/100 = 100 ÷ 100 = 100% = 1

Multiply a number by the fraction 100/100,

... and its value doesn't change.

Calculate the percent value:

0.611 =

0.611 × 100/100 =

(0.611 × 100)/100 =

61.1/100 =

61.1%;

In other words:

1) Multiply that number by 100.

2) Add the percent sign % to it.
